Skip to product information
1 of 3

Ibiyaya-Comfort+ Pet Stroller Add-on Kit (L) - Blush

Ibiyaya-Comfort+ Pet Stroller Add-on Kit (L) - Blush

Regular price 18.500 KWD
Regular price Sale price 18.500 KWD
Sale Sold out
View full details